How Much Does Land Clearing Really Cost?
Determining a price of land clearing can prove surprisingly complex. Several aspects influence the overall sum, ranging from the size of the property to the kind of vegetation found. Generally, you can expect to pay anywhere from $3 to $15 each square area, but this kind of spectrum is highly variable. Consider that stumps, rocks, and heavy brush can significantly boost a task’s price. Furthermore, unique equipment, licenses, and hauling fees several add onto the final charge.

Clearing Land: Choosing the Right Equipment
Effectively leveling acreage for development requires thoughtful selection of the suitable equipment. The best choice depends on several considerations, including the scope of the site, the nature of the undergrowth, and your budget . For modest areas with minimal brush , a brush cutter and physical tools may suffice. However, extensive removal projects frequently necessitate heavier machinery such as a tractor with a brush hog , or even a land bulldozer . Think about renting if you only need the equipment for a short period, balancing the cost against the advantages of buying it.
